# Runbook: SDK Parity — Quillbase Clients

The Tessane (Go) and Marlow (Kotlin) SDKs must expose identical retry and pagination behavior. Parity checks run nightly; a failure pages on-call. If paged: confirm both SDKs pin the same API schema revision, then rerun the parity suite against staging. Do not hotfix one SDK alone. The parity harness reads the following settings at startup.

deployment values, kajep-kageg:
[praix]
host = praix.paliqcorp.corp
user = praix_svc
database = praix_prod

## Approvals: Websocket Reconnect Fix

This page tracks sign-off for the patch addressing the reconnect storm in the Pondbridge gateway, where dropped websocket sessions retried without backoff and overwhelmed the edge nodes. The fix adds jittered exponential backoff and caps concurrent reconnect attempts per client. QA has verified behavior under simulated network flaps, and load testing passed on staging. Before we schedule the rollout, we need one final approval per our change policy. The approver responsible for this change is named below.

account owner for tawip-kahop: Oliok Jorix Ulaath Quenok

## Tuning

GiftPost batches donation receipts before handing them to the send queue. Batch size and retry backoff interact: raising one without the other causes duplicate receipts under provider timeouts, which finance at Larkmont Trust will notice immediately. Verify staging numbers against last quarter's peak before each release cut. The constants below are the only values you should adjust.

limits module of hadug-hahop:
PRIORITIES = {
    "zorwyn": 182,
    "ralael": 588,
    "aldax": 782,
}

**Ticket: Vault locked after gateway rate-limit change**

Deploying the new token-bucket rules to the Copperline gateway tripped the anomaly detector: the config service hit its own limit mid-rotation and the policy vault sealed itself. Review the diff in the rate-limit module before we redeploy — the burst allowance math looks off by one window. To unseal the vault and rerun the rotation, the reviewer needs the recovery passphrase, included below for this ticket only.

vault phrase of bagaf-kajeg = jorath-feniel-briir-siliel-ralix